Bold, "neon" colours that I've tried so far seem to have the same characteristics to me. If you try to layer too many coats on, the colour becomes less and less true to what you see in the bottle. To achieve the true neon colour, it's best to use a milky base coat with some sort of pigment, or white polish underneath the neon colour. For this polish, I used my Essie fill the gap base coat. After additional coats of Pink Shock, I noticed the colour become darker and less true to the colour seen in the bottle. So I decided to paint another coat of the Essie base coat before painting another coat of the neon, and the colour turned out brilliantly.
So yeah, there's a small tip for you guys in regards to neon polishes. I haven't tried many neons... I'm not a huge fan of other bright colours besides pinky colours, I guess. But if your neon isn't turning out the way you want, try a milky base coat or a white polish under it, and the colour will show up much nicer.
